Emerson Has Career-High 19 Saves, But Knights Fall Late to Skidmore
Potsdam, NY – Senior Griffin Emerson made 19 saves over the course of four quarters for the Clarkson University Men’s Lacrosse team, but Skidmore scored when it counted late, picking up five goals in the final five minutes to down the Golden Knights 11-7 in Liberty League play on Saturday afternoon at Hantz Field. The Golden Knights fell to 7-4 overall and 1-3 in the Liberty League, while Skidmore improved to 10-2 and 3-1. Clarkson is at home against St. Lawrence on Wednesday.
